Solo Bar, Coro SATB, 2 Vl, Va, Vc, Cb, Org - Level 3 SKU: CA.7030900 Composed by Gabriel Faure. Edited by Jean-Michel Nectoux. French Sacred Music. With strings, separate edition with complete edition. Sacred vocal music. Full score. Composed 1872. Duration 2 minutes. Carus Verlag #CV 70.309/00. Published by Carus Verlag (CA.7030900). ISBN 9790007244767. Key: C major. Language: Latin.Women's and men's voices and the baritone soloist sing in alternating dialog. The composition was probably written in 1872, at a time when Faure was working alongside Charles-Marie Widor as organist an the church of Saint-Sulpice in Paris. The organ version with mixed voice chorus and baritone solo can be complemented with the addition of a string quintet. The score of the version without strings (Carus 70.301/20) is at the same time a chorus score and organ part for the version with strings.
